William Addo

[1] Before making appearances in several Ghanaian films, William Addo worked as a theater performer.

[2] He attended the University of Ghana where he obtained a degree in Drama and Theatre Studies and was retained as a teaching assistant because of his performance.

Following unsuccessful surgeries, William Addo has become completely blind and is making a plea for help in raising funds for medication.

[4][5] He disclosed that although doctors had diagnosed him with glaucoma and cataracts, they had also informed him that his condition was incurable.
